Indian Metals & Ferro Alloys Appoints Partha Satpathy As Non-Executive Independent Director

Indian Metals & Ferro Alloys Limited has appointed Partha Satpathy as an Additional Director (Non-Executive Independent) on its Board, with effective from September 5, 2026, for a period of three years, subject to the approval of shareholders.

Satpathy is a former Ambassador and diplomat with over 35 years of experience, including 15 years at ambassadorial levels. He served as Ambassador of India to Hungary and Bosnia & Herzegovina from 2022 to 2025; Ambassador to Ukraine from 2018 to 2022; and Ambassador to Senegal, Gambia, Guinea-Bissau and Cabo Verde from 2012 to 2015. His career also includes assignments with the Ministry of External Affairs, including as Head of the Latin America and Caribbean Division, Head of the States of India Division, Minister at the Permanent Mission of India in Geneva, and Head of Economic Relations at the Embassy of India in Moscow. He has represented India on executive Boards of international and specialised UN organisations, including the WHO, ILO, HRC, WMO, ITU and WIPO. He holds a Master’s in Business Administration from IIM Ahmedabad, a Master’s in International Human Rights and Law from the University of Essex, and a Bachelor of Science in Physics from Hindu College, University of Delhi. He also holds a Financial Times Non-Executive Director Diploma.
